Just got them on today and running 37 PSI. .They do look a little rounded on the top and the bottom outside edges are not touching the pavement. (I don't know if they even should). Initially I didn't feel any difference but after a 40 mile trip to the dealer for a speedometer re calibration (which they couldn't do) think they tend to drift a bit. They currently don't have the right equipment to do the re calibration, the one that did the JK won't work on the JL and they recommended a Superchips flash calibrator, part # 3571Jl. I will be looking for some 9" rims in the meantime.
